A study conducted by the Center for Injury Research and Policy found, “an estimated 5.25 million football-related injuries among children and adolescents between 6 and 17 years of age were treated in U.S. emergency departments between 1990 and 2007. The annual number of football-related injuries increased 27 percent during the 18-year study period, jumping from 274,094 in 1990 to 346,772 in 2007” (Nation 201). These reported injuries include sprains and strains, broken bones, cracked ribs, torn ligaments, and concussions. A concussion usually happens when a player takes a hard hit to the head or is knocked unconscious on the playing field, and if not diagnosed and treated quickly, a concussion can result in death.

The National Football League (NFL) is a very popular sport in America. It is known for its spectacular touchdowns and amazing comeback stories. But most of all, the hard hits from one player to another. There’s been a lot of controversy over the protection of the players and the punishment of those who put others in danger with these hits. The NFL enforced strict rules against players who collide with other players in the case of a helmet-to-helmet hit, such as penalties and huge fines. A helmet-to-helmet hit is when a defender uses his helmet to hit the helmet of a defenseless offensive player. This is what to be called as a dangerous action to do in the NFL. The league created these rules to make the game safer. The causes of these rules being applied were the depression of the players once they receive the hit to the head, a disease that was found in former players after collisions, and concussions.

While the use of helmets does aid in protecting players from brain trauma, they also increase the risky behavior of players; this is called risk compensation. Risk compensation is the adjustment of individual behavior, responding to the perceived changes in risk (TheFreeDictionary.com). Most people that wear helmets have a pre-conceived idea that, because they have a helmet on, they can possess more daring behaviors and be fine. The helmet is basically thought of as a tool to hit harder, or improve performance in today’s culture. Adventure writer and pilot, Lane Wallace (2011) accurately understands the dangers of helmets being used incorrectly, and how they are used as weapons instead of safety.
